π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Continuously analyze data across marketing channels to understand performance and identify areas for improvement

βœ… Deliver comprehensive funnel analysis, providing clear insights into lead generation, conversion rates, and customer engagement

βœ… Act as a subject matter expert for all data-driven requests, unlocking valuable insights from Fullscript’s data

βœ… Collaborate with cross-functional marketing teams to prioritize data requests and ensure strategies are continuously optimized

βœ… Develop functional requirements and user stories to ensure clear communication with technical teams

🎯 Required Qualifications

Education: Bachelor's degree in Digital Marketing, Marketing Analytics, or a related field

Experience: 8+ years of experience in marketing, with a focus on B2B/B2C growth marketing, ideally within healthcare, SaaS, or similar sectors

Required Skills:

  • Expertise in digital marketing data and hands-on experience with platforms such as Google Analytics, Iterable, Hubspot, and Salesforce Marketing Cloud
  • Proficiency in reporting and analytics tools, such as Looker Studio, Tableau, and experience with Snowflake or other data warehouse platforms
  • Strong ability to analyze complex data sets and deliver actionable insights to non-technical stakeholders
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to articulate data insights in an accessible way to marketing teams and senior leadership
  • Experience collaborating with internal and external partners to drive marketing performance

Preferred Skills:

  • Previous experience in the health and wellness or SaaS industry
  • Familiarity with the customer journey in health and wellness, particularly for healthcare providers and patients
  • Account-Based Marketing (ABM) strategies
  • Experience with A/B testing to refine campaigns and improve results
  • Knowledge of lead management frameworks
